Microwave assisted synthesis of 3-(Tetrahydro- 3,4,5-trihydroxy-6-hydroxymethyl-2H-pyran-2- yloxy)-2-aryl/heteroaryl-4H-chromones and their biological importance

Mangesh Gharpure, Vishwas Ingle, Harjeet Juneja, Ratiram Choudhary and Nilesh Gandhare

This research communication is toward the investigation of microwave synthesis and biological evaluation of 3-(tetrahydro-3,4,5-trihydroxy-6-hydroxymethyl-2H-pyran-2-yloxy)-2-aryl/heteroaryl-4H-chromones (3-O-􀈕-Dglucopyranosyloxyflavones). These compounds have been obtained by the interaction of α-acetobromoglucose with 3- hydroxy-2-aryl/heteroaryl-4H-chromones under microwave condition. The structures of these newly synthesized 3-O- 􀈕-D-glucopyranosides were established on the basis of chemical, elemental, and spectral analyses. Further, All compounds were evaluated for antimicrobial activity. The inhibition caused by 3-hydroxy flavones was relatively low whereas that of its 3-O-􀈕-D-glucopyranosides analogues was substantially more
